.bee-video-03{background-position:50%;background-repeat:no-repeat;background-size:cover;display:block;height:50vh;position:relative;width:100%}.bee-video-03:before{background-color:var(--dark);content:"";height:100%;left:0;opacity:.25;position:absolute;top:0;transition:.3s ease;width:100%;z-index:1}.bee-video-03:hover:before{opacity:.2}.bee-video-03 .bee-container{position:static;z-index:2}.bee-video-03_button{bottom:0;height:8rem;left:0;margin:auto;position:absolute;right:0;top:0;width:8rem;z-index:3}.bee-video-03_button svg{height:2rem}.bee-video-03.overlay-gdpr:before{background-color:#a9a9a9;opacity:.5}.bee-video-03.overlay-both_together.moved-to-step2:before{background-color:#000;opacity:.5}.overlay-both_together .bee-container .bee-video-03_button.step2,.overlay-gdpr .bee-container .bee-video-03_button{border:0;display:flex;flex-direction:column;height:100%!important;max-width:550px;padding:5%;text-align:center;width:100%!important}.overlay-both_together button.cta_button,.overlay-gdpr button.cta_button{background-color:#fc0;border:none;color:#231f20;cursor:pointer;display:inline-block;font-size:20px;font-weight:700;padding:12px 30px}.overlay-both_together h3,.overlay-both_together p,.overlay-gdpr h3,.overlay-gdpr p{color:#fff}.overlay-both_together p,.overlay-gdpr p{font-size:14px}.bee-video-03_button button.cta_button_redirect{background-color:transparent;color:#fff;cursor:pointer;font-weight:700;padding:0;text-decoration:underline}@media (max-width:767px){a.bee-video-cm{min-height:350px}}a.two-steps{cursor:pointer}.event-page .bee-container .bee-video-03_button{border-color:#fff}.event-page .bee-container .bee-video-03_button svg path{fill:#fff}